#baf59b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#baf59b is composed of 72.9% red, 96.1%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 99.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 78.4%. #baf59b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#75eb37.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

The hexadecimal color #baf59b has RGB values of R:186, G:245,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12252571.

Shades and Tints of #baf59b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030701 is the darkest color, while #f8fef4 is the lightest one.
